Overview
The C0603X5R1A154M030BB is a high-quality ceramic capacitor (MLCC) manufactured by TDK, a global leader in electronic components. This passive component is designed to store and release electrical energy, filter noise, and stabilize voltage in a wide range of electronic circuits. As a multi-layer ceramic capacitor, it offers excellent performance characteristics in a compact surface-mount package, making it ideal for modern, miniaturized electronic designs. TDK’s commitment to precision engineering ensures that this capacitor delivers reliable operation in demanding commercial-grade applications.
Key Specifications
- Apps.: Commercial Grade
This specification indicates that the capacitor is designed and tested to meet the rigorous performance and reliability standards required for commercial electronic products. It signifies suitability for a broad spectrum of applications where consistent operation is crucial, rather than specialized automotive or industrial environments. - Brand: TDK
TDK is a renowned Japanese multinational electronics company known for its high-quality electronic components, including capacitors, inductors, and magnetic products. Specifying TDK assures buyers of a product backed by extensive research, development, and manufacturing expertise, leading to superior performance and longevity. - Feature: General
The ‘General’ feature denotes that this capacitor is suitable for a wide array of standard decoupling, bypass, and filtering applications. It is not optimized for highly specialized functions like high-frequency RF or high-power applications, but rather provides robust performance for everyday circuit requirements. - Tolerance: ±20%
This value indicates the permissible deviation of the actual capacitance from its nominal value (150nF). A ±20% tolerance is common for general-purpose ceramic capacitors, suitable for applications where precise capacitance values are not absolutely critical, such as power supply decoupling or non-precision timing circuits. - L x W Size: 0.6mm x 0.3mm [EIA 0201]
This specifies the physical dimensions of the capacitor in a surface-mount package. The 0.6mm x 0.3mm size corresponds to the EIA 0201 standard, which is one of the smallest available package sizes for MLCCs. This ultra-compact footprint is crucial for miniaturized electronic devices where board space is at a premium, enabling high-density component placement. - Capacitance: 150nF
The nominal capacitance value of 150 nanofarads (nF), or 0.15 microfarads (µF), defines the component’s ability to store electrical charge. This value is commonly used for decoupling integrated circuits, filtering power supply lines, and in various timing and resonant circuits. - T(Max.) / mm: 0.33
This refers to the maximum thickness of the component, specified as 0.33 millimeters. Along with the length and width, this dimension is critical for mechanical design and automated assembly processes, ensuring the component fits within specified height constraints on a PCB. - Temp. Chara.: X5R
X5R is a dielectric material classification that defines the capacitor’s performance over a temperature range. X5R capacitors are suitable for general-purpose applications, offering a capacitance change of no more than ±15% over an operating temperature range of -55°C to +85°C. This makes them a versatile choice for many commercial and consumer electronics. - Component Type: Ceramic Capacitor (MLCC)
This confirms the fundamental nature of the component as a Multi-Layer Ceramic Capacitor. MLCCs are known for their high volumetric efficiency, low equivalent series resistance (ESR), and excellent high-frequency performance, making them ubiquitous in modern electronics. - Product Status: Production(NRND)
NRND stands for ‘Not Recommended for New Designs’. While the product is currently in production and available, this status suggests that the manufacturer recommends using a newer or alternative part for new product developments. It’s important for designers to be aware of this for long-term product lifecycle planning. - Rated Voltage [DC] / V: 10
This is the maximum DC voltage that can be continuously applied across the capacitor without causing damage or premature failure. A 10V rating makes this capacitor suitable for low-voltage digital and analog circuits, common in battery-powered devices and microcontrollers. - Cap.Change or Temp.Coef.: ±15%
This reiterates the capacitance change over temperature, directly linked to the X5R dielectric characteristic. It means the capacitance value will remain within ±15% of its nominal value across the specified operating temperature range, ensuring stable circuit performance. - Operating Temp. Range / °C: -55 to 85
This defines the ambient temperature range within which the capacitor is designed to operate reliably and meet its specified electrical characteristics. The wide range of -55°C to +85°C makes it suitable for many indoor and outdoor commercial applications, excluding extreme industrial or automotive environments.

Typical Applications
- Power Supply Decoupling: In digital circuits, this capacitor is widely used to decouple integrated circuits (ICs) from the power supply rail. Its function is to provide a local reservoir of charge, smoothing out transient current demands from the IC and preventing voltage dips that could lead to logic errors or instability. Its small size is ideal for placement close to IC pins.
- Signal Filtering: The C0603X5R1A154M030BB can be employed in low-pass or high-pass filter circuits to remove unwanted noise or select specific frequency bands. For instance, in sensor interfaces, it can filter out high-frequency noise from sensor readings, ensuring cleaner and more accurate data acquisition.
- Bypass Capacitors: These capacitors are placed in parallel with power lines to provide a low-impedance path for high-frequency noise to ground, effectively bypassing the noise around sensitive components. This helps maintain signal integrity and reduces electromagnetic interference (EMI) within the circuit.
- Timing Circuits: While not a precision capacitor, the C0603X5R1A154M030BB can be used in non-critical timing applications, such as RC oscillators or delay circuits, where a ±20% tolerance is acceptable. Its small size makes it suitable for compact timing solutions.
- Portable Electronic Devices: Given its ultra-compact 0201 package and 10V rated voltage, this capacitor is perfectly suited for use in smartphones, tablets, wearables, and other battery-powered portable devices where space and power efficiency are paramount.
